New Appointment Requirements Since 2025

Important Changes

Effective January 6, 2025, the Oklahoma City Social Security office implemented a mandatory appointment system. Here's what you need to know:

  • All routine visits require appointments scheduled in advance
  • Walk-in service is limited to emergency situations only
  • Same-day appointments may be available for urgent matters
  • Appointments help reduce wait times and improve service quality
  • No appointment fees - this service remains free

This change brings Oklahoma City in line with Social Security offices nationwide, ensuring more efficient service delivery and better resource management.

Walk-in Exceptions and Emergency Situations

While appointments are now required, the Oklahoma City office still accepts walk-ins for certain urgent situations:

Emergency Walk-in Situations

Walk-in service is available for these urgent circumstances:

  • Critical need for immediate replacement Social Security card
  • Emergency benefit payments or urgent financial hardship
  • Imminent homelessness or eviction situations
  • Medical emergencies affecting benefit status
  • Death of a beneficiary requiring immediate reporting

If you believe you have an emergency situation, arrive early in the day and be prepared to explain your circumstances. Emergency walk-ins are served after scheduled appointments, so wait times may be significant.

What to Bring

The specific documents you need depend on your reason for visiting, but commonly required items include:

  • Government-issued photo ID (driver's license, passport, etc.)
  • Social Security card (if available)
  • Birth certificate or proof of citizenship
  • Marriage certificate or divorce decree (if applicable)
  • Medical records (for disability claims)
  • Bank account information for direct deposit
